Crucial Facts About Nerve Damage After Knee Replacement
Nerve damage after knee replacement is a significant concern for patients. This complication can affect recovery and long-term outcomes. Understanding the risks associated with nerve injury is essential for informed decision-making. Many patients are unaware of the specific nerves affected by knee surgery.
Research indicates that approximately 1-5% of patients may experience nerve injury after knee replacement. The most commonly affected nerves include the peroneal nerve and the saphenous nerve. Damage to these nerves can lead to symptoms such as numbness, tingling, or weakness in the leg. Causes of Nerve Injury During Knee Replacement Surgery
Top causes of nerve injury during knee replacement surgery can vary. Surgeons must navigate complex anatomy, which poses certain risks. Complications may arise due to improper positioning or surgical techniques. Recognizing these causes is essential for minimizing nerve damage.
Improper surgical technique is a leading cause of nerve damage. Surgeons need to be cautious while handling surrounding tissues. Excessive retraction during the procedure may stretch or compress nerves. Such knee surgery complications can result in significant nerve injury after knee replacement.
One common cause is anatomical variations in the patient. Some individuals have unique nerve pathways that surgeons may not anticipate. This can increase the likelihood of nerve damage during surgery. Awareness of these risks can help patients prepare for their procedures.
Patient positioning on the operating table also plays a crucial role. If a leg is positioned incorrectly, pressure may affect the nerves. This can result in temporary or permanent nerve issues. Discussing the risks of knee replacement surgery with surgeons can provide clarity.

Long-Term Effects: What Happens if Nerve Damage Occurs?
Long-term effects of nerve damage can significantly impact recovery after surgery. Patients may experience persistent symptoms that affect daily life. Nerve pain following knee surgery can vary in intensity and duration. Recognizing these potential complications is crucial for effective management.
Chronic pain is one of the most common outcomes of nerve injury. Some individuals may develop neuropathic pain, which feels different from regular pain. This type of pain can manifest as burning, tingling, or sharp sensations. Addressing these symptoms early is vital for improving quality of life.
Nerve injury recovery can also lead to functional limitations. Patients may struggle with mobility or coordination due to compromised nerve function. Weakness in the affected leg can hinder rehabilitation efforts. Focusing on targeted physical therapy can help regain strength and improve function.
